Transaction e21b2d73bfffe541faf4ab0dd0238aa3a07771d1546c80b0a20d0543e1352384
1 Input
1 Output
-
e21b2d73bfffe541faf4ab0dd0238aa3a07771d1546c80b0a20d0543e1352384:0
- value
- 125062
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6a8688131efecff7a17cab538bb48916ac42a64 OP_EQUAL
- address
- 3QBDtwcTs122DBsK1PTV5exHgKPpjLV5cz